In addition, a game can take from a few minutes to one hour to complete, meaning actions taken early in the game may not pay-off for a long time. Part of StarCraft’s longevity is down to the rich, multi-layered gameplay, which also makes it an ideal environment for AI research.įor example, while the objective of the game is to beat the opponent, the player must also carry out and balance a number of sub-goals, such as gathering resources or building structures. The original game is also already used by AI and ML researchers, who compete annually in the AIIDE bot competition.
StarCraft and StarCraft II are among the biggest and most successful games of all time, with players competing in tournaments for more than 20 years.
#Starcraft 2 game path full
A joint paper that outlines the environment, and reports initial baseline results on the mini-games, supervised learning from replays, and the full 1v1 ladder game against the built-in AI.
#Starcraft 2 game path series
A series of simple RL mini-games to allow researchers to test the performance of agents on specific tasks.An open source version of DeepMind’s toolset, PySC2, to allow researchers to easily use Blizzard’s feature-layer API with their agents.A dataset of anonymised game replays, which will increase from 65k to more than half a million in the coming weeks.
This includes the release of tools for Linux for the first time. A Machine Learning API developed by Blizzard that gives researchers and developers hooks into the game.That is why we, along with our partner Blizzard Entertainment, are excited to announce the release of SC2LE, a set of tools that we hope will accelerate AI research in the real-time strategy game StarCraft II. Testing our agents in games that are not specifically designed for AI research, and where humans play well, is crucial to benchmark agent performance. To do this, we design agents and test their ability in a wide range of environments from the purpose-built DeepMind Lab to established games, such as Atari and Go. DeepMind's scientific mission is to push the boundaries of AI by developing systems that can learn to solve complex problems.